NAME

     fstobdf - generate BDF font from X font server

SYNOPSIS

     fstobdf [ -server server ] -fn fontname

DESCRIPTION

     The fstobdf program reads a font from a font server and
     prints a BDF file on the standard output that may be used to
     recreate the font. This is useful in testing servers, debug-
     ging font metrics, and reproducing lost BDF files.

OPTIONS

     -server servername
             This option specifies the server from which the font
             should be read.

     -fn fontname
             This option specifies the font for which a BDF file
             should be generated.

ENVIRONMENT

     FONTSERVER
             default server to use
